Accessible, joyful and practical
The practice of mindfulness, being present physically and mentally, is an ancient art that is slowly catching on in our modern society. What makes this book worth reading is the accessibility of "HOW" to bring mindfulness alive in a world of many distractions. The author brings such passion to her writing that I was fully sold on the value of her message. Ms. Cameron also starts each chapter with inspiring quotes. One that resonated with me in Chapter 11, is by the poet and philosopher Mark Nepo. "Our challenge each day is not to get dressed to face the world but to unglove ourselves so that the doorknob feels cold and the car handle feels wet and the kiss goodbye feels like the lips of another being, soft and unrepeatable." This book helped me get in touch with the many joys available to me in life that are often masked by the veil of constant doing. Give yourself a gift; be the productive person AND live moment to moment. I encourage you to read this book.

A useful, practical guide for busy people!
I truly LOVE this book! It is easy to read and filled with straightforward, kind and compassionate advice for adding mindful practices to your life. Without any pretension or preaching, the author provides helpful tips and tricks for taking that much needed pause to bring calm and focus to your day. The structure is really helpful, walking you through the key moments of the day and pointing out tips for each point in time. It provides a useful guide and easy way to start constructive habits. I also greatly appreciate the references to the research behind mindfulness practices. For me, understanding the “why” makes it easier to incorporate these practices into my day. I’ve already gained a couple great new habits and look forward to incorporating more! The author also includes great tips for building and sustaining new practices so that they will stick with you long after you finish reading.
